KAEC exhibits residential units
Published in The Saudi Gazette on 22 - 10 - 2016

KING Abdullah Economic City (KAEC) has announced that an exhibition of residential units located in the award winning Al-Waha district will be held on Oct. 20-22 at the Jeddah Hilton Hotel. A wide variety of residential units will be available from studio apartments from SR299,000 plus one and two bedroom apartments, larger town homes, duplex villas, and four bedroom detached villas to accommodate all budgets and family sizes.
"We are delighted with the overwhelming success of Al-Waha, which has proven to be one of the most popular residential districts in KAEC," said Fahd Al-Rasheed, Group CEO and managing director of KAEC. "We are committed to making homeownership possible for all Saudi citizens, which is a key part of the many contributions that KAEC is making towards realizing Saudi Vision 2030," he added:"
Charles Biele, CEO of the Real Estate Development Company (REDCO) in KAEC said, "Al-Waha offers its residents, new state-of-the-art infrastructure along with best in class community facilities. Beautifully designed in a combination of Arabian, Moroccan, Spanish and Italian architectural styles, Al-Waha offers a wide variety of residential accommodations, including attractive and affordable studio and one-bedroom apartments that are specifically designed for first time buyers and newlyweds who want to purchase their own home. Al Waha is also highly desirable community for investors offering a promising opportunity for rental income along with capital gains yields."
Al-Waha is a Cityscape award winning community, which fulfills residents' desires for a modern lifestyle while maintaining its appeal as a peaceful and family-friendly environment with a variety of amenities including a community center with a residents' clubhouse, a children's play area, a swimming pool, and landscaped parks and walking areas to ensure a healthy and active lifestyle.
Al-Waha residents benefit from KAEC's existing lifestyle elements including mosques, health care facilities, the highest quality schools, world-class universities, retail outlets, and a variety of beach and marina waterfront dining options.

Located on the west coast of Saudi Arabia, King Abdullah Economic City is the largest privately developed city in the world, and approximately the size of Washington, D.C. King Abdullah Economic City is a fully integrated environment to work, live and play, connected by a major port and the national road and rail networks.
The mega project consists of: the coastal communities offering total housing solutions for all segments of society; King Abdullah Port which is being developed to be one of the largest ports in the world; the Hejaz district that includes the Haramain Railway station; and the Industrial Valley which is linked to the port and has signed with more than 110 leading national and international companies.
